For students at home or in the classroom, Music Composition Toolbox is an invaluable guide to creating and notating original composition. The self-contained module topics include guidance on developing a motive, additive rhythm, reducing and elaborating melodies, using cycles, organising material and using your inner ear. Features include:
• 21 easy-to-navigate modules
• Over 120 practical exercises
• Great tips for generating musical ideas
• Extensive musical examples with an Australian focus
• Tips for score presentation
Also includes an accompanying audio CD.
Suitable for Year 11-12 students or early tertiary students.
